The Senior Manufacturing Scientist - Technical Services at Beckman Coulter Diagnostics is responsible for activities required to co-ordinate and support Technical Services investigations and routine product maintenance Operations activities for the AU and CSCA Business Units. Additionally the role will support CSCA design transfer activities for new Haematology products.

This position is part of the AU Technical Operations Department located in Lismeehan, O’Callaghan’s Mills, Co. Clare and will be an onsite position. At Beckman Coulter, our vision is to relentlessly reimagine healthcare, one diagnosis at a time.
You will be a part of the Technical Operations Team and report to the Manager, Manufacturing Science, Operations /Technical Services, with a direct line to the Senior Manager of AU Technical Operations.
